Folios 89-90: Charles Malcolm, HMS Rhin, Plymouth Sound. Having wrote the Principal Officers and Commissioners of His Majesty's Navy, relative to the accounts of Mr John Brown Boatswain of HMS Rhin and being referred by them to the Admiralty. He send a copy of Mr John Brown's receipts for the satisfaction of their Lordships by which you will observe he delivered his accounts into the proper office. Requests a dispensing order so he may receive his pay.
Folio 91: enclosure with folios 89-90. (Copy) Received from Mr John Brown, Boatswain of HMS Rhin a Box directed to the Clerk of the Survey Naval Yard Plymouth, said to contain his annual accounts to the 9 March 1814. Signed Thomas Parsland Naval Storekeeper.
Folio 92 enclosure [Attached] with folios 89-90: [Proforma] Document to be sent to the Paper Office when any Paper is sent away in original. Date - 19 May 1815, From - Captain Charles Malcolm, Subject - Accounts of John Brown as Boatswain of HMS Rhin to be dispensed with, Date - 22 May [1815], Nature - Refer to the Navy Board.
